Understanding the Threats and Benefits of LASIK
While LASIK offers the guarantee of boosted vision, it's necessary to comprehend both the dangers and benefits prior to proceeding. The key advantage is the capacity for minimized dependancy on glasses or call lenses, which can improve your quality of life. Most individuals experience considerable vision renovation, often accomplishing 20/25 vision or far better.
However, there are risks included. Complications can consist of completely dry eyes, glare, halos, and even vision loss in unusual cases.
